Lol what? This game is BRILLIANT. It has a fantastic and moving story about a woman suffering from psychosis. Its audio design, best experienced with over-ear headphones, simulates the sensation of hearing voices inside your head, like a person suffering psychosis might. The puzzles are all built on broken perception, requiring the player to both recognize and compensate for this fact in order to solve them.
It's a heart wrenching story with gorgeous visuals and amazing audio.
